Measurements and Supplies for Todays 3D purse Gift Card Holder:
- I used an Basic White piece 6” by 4 ½”, scored and folded at 3”
- I used either Gold or Silver Foil 2 pieces 1 piece 7” by ½” for the handle, a second piece ½” by 5” for the mechanism inside the purse to secure your gift, a third piece a small piece 1″ by 2″ scored and folded at 1″ for the purse tab
- Also a small piece of scrap to cut a small circle for the purse closure in gold or silver
